下面一条逻辑题,:甲乙丙丁四人的车分别为白色、银色、蓝色和红色.在问到他们各自车的颜色时,甲说:“乙的车不是白色.”乙说:“丙的车是红色的.”丙说:“丁的车不是蓝色的.”丁说:“甲、乙、丙三人中有一个人的车是红色的,而且只有这个人说的是实话如果丁说的是实话,那么以下说法正确的是( ).A.甲的车是白色的,乙的车是银色的 B.乙的车是蓝色的,丙的车是红色的C.丙的车是白色的,丁的车是蓝色的 D.丁的车是银色的,甲的车是红色的为什么,乙不可能说实话,否则乙和丙的车都是红色的,不符合题意?明明说是丙是红色怎么扯到乙是红色的了?那里看出来?我怎么看不懂 或许我比较笨

问题描述:

下面一条逻辑题,
:甲乙丙丁四人的车分别为白色、银色、蓝色和红色.在问到他们各自车的颜色时,甲说:“乙的车不是白色.”乙说:“丙的车是红色的.”丙说:“丁的车不是蓝色的.”丁说:“甲、乙、丙三人中有一个人的车是红色的,而且只有这个人说的是实话如果丁说的是实话,那么以下说法正确的是( ).
A.甲的车是白色的,乙的车是银色的 B.乙的车是蓝色的,丙的车是红色的
C.丙的车是白色的,丁的车是蓝色的 D.丁的车是银色的,甲的车是红色的
为什么,乙不可能说实话,否则乙和丙的车都是红色的,不符合题意?明明说是丙是红色怎么扯到乙是红色的了?那里看出来?我怎么看不懂 或许我比较笨

三长两短 一样长选C

题干中很重要的一个关键就是“甲、乙、丙三人中有一个人的车是红色的,而且只有这个人说的是实话”(注意“只有”二字),也就是说这位三个人里有且只有一个人的车为红色,并且说了真话。
另外题干的第一句话“甲乙丙丁四人的车分别为白色、银色、蓝色和红色。”注意“分别”二字,也就是说不可能出现两个人同时为红车的情况。
由于甲乙丙所说的内容,只有乙说的和红车有关,所以我们不妨首先假设乙为真→乙车红,丙车红,显然与题意不符。
所以乙为假→乙车非红且丙车非红→#甲车为红#(因为甲乙丙三者有一为红)→甲为真→乙车非白
上面的“丙车非红”→丙为假→#丁车为蓝#→乙车非蓝→#乙车为银#(因为前面推出的乙车非红、非白、非蓝,只可能为银色)
注意前面用“##”标示出来的结论(其实这时候已经可以用排除法选出答案了)
三个结论为:#甲车为红#、#丁车为蓝#、#乙车为银#,剩下的丙车只能为白色了。答案为C。

假设,甲真.则(甲红)——丙假——(丁蓝)——乙假——(丙白)——(乙银)
假设,乙真.则丙和丁都是红,不符合,
假设,丙真.则(丙红)——乙真.不符合.
结论,只有可能是甲真.
对比ABCD,全部不符合.